Through Gmail you can send up to 25MB of files, which may not be enough when sharing a large PDF report or a document full of many photos. Large files uploaded to your Gmail from your computer can be difficult or even impossible to send, but thanks to the Google Drive shortcut, it's possible to send large files through your Gmail account.
At the bottom of the Compose window, you'll see an icon for Google Drive. Click that icon and then, in the resulting popup, click the My Drive tab, navigate to the folder housing the large file
